Technical Field

The invention relates to the technical field of laser processing equipment, in particular to a cigarette laser drilling device.

Background

With the improvement of living standard, people pay attention to the harm of cigarettes to human bodies while satisfying the sensory stimulation of cigarettes. The reduction of tar content of cigarettes has become a trend in the tobacco industry. Further reducing the tar content of the cigarette, improving the technical content of the product and increasing the added value of the product, thereby expanding the market consumption and improving the economic benefit. The method is a necessary way for cigarette enterprises to live in competition and develop in competition. The cigarette online laser boring technology is an economic, fast and effective means for reducing tar. The cigarette is made by punching tipping paper with high-energy laser in the middle of filter tip to form tiny holes, and when the cigarette is smoked, the cigarette dilutes smoke, thereby reducing tar content and harmful effects on human body and environment.

When punching cigarette, need punch along a cigarette round, current cigarette punches and adopts laser beam drilling drum wheel and cigarette rubbing wheel to realize a cigarette rotation and punch more, but the drum that punches and cigarette rubbing wheel structure are complicated, and difficult installation leads to the effect of punching not accurate, influences the qualification rate of cigarette production.

In order to achieve the purpose, the invention is realized by the following technical scheme: a cigarette laser drilling device comprises a base, wherein a workbench is fixedly connected to the top of the base, a vertically arranged main shaft is hinged to the top of the workbench, a driving motor for driving the main shaft to rotate is arranged in the base and is connected with the main shaft in a linkage manner, a rotating block is fixedly connected to the top of the main shaft, a fixing cylinder concentrically arranged with the main shaft is sleeved on the outer side of the main shaft, a conical tooth ring is fixedly connected to the top of the fixing cylinder, a plurality of laser drilling mechanisms are arranged on the side face of the rotating block and comprise a bevel gear, a rotating shaft, a fixing seat and a laser transmitter, the rotating shaft is horizontally arranged, one end of the rotating shaft is hinged to the rotating block, the other end of the rotating shaft is fixedly connected with the bevel gear, the bevel gear is meshed with the conical tooth ring, one side, away from the rotating shaft, of the bevel gear is fixedly connected with the fixing seat, a cigarette body is arranged in the fixing seat, and the laser transmitter is arranged right above the cigarette body.

Preferably, the diameter of the bevel gear is half of the diameter of the bevel gear ring.

Preferably, the number of the laser punching mechanisms is two, and the two laser punching mechanisms are symmetrically arranged on two sides of the rotating shaft.

(III) advantageous effects

The invention provides a cigarette laser drilling device. The method has the following beneficial effects:

1. when the cigarette laser punching device is used, firstly, a cigarette body is inserted into a fixed seat in a direction towards the outside of a cigarette holder, a driving motor is started, the driving motor drives a main shaft to rotate for a circle, the main shaft drives a rotating block to rotate, the rotating block drives a bevel gear at one end of a rotating shaft to do circular motion by taking the main shaft as the center, and the bevel gear is meshed with a bevel gear ring, so that the bevel gear can rotate in the circular motion process, the bevel gear drives the fixed seat to do circular motion by taking the main shaft as the center and simultaneously generate autorotation, the fixed seat drives the cigarette body to do circular motion by taking the main shaft as the center and simultaneously generate autorotation, a laser transmitter is intermittently started to perform annular punching on the cigarette body in the process of one circle of the main shaft rotation, and the cigarette body is taken out of the fixed seat after punching is completed, the whole structure is simple, the cigarette laser punching device is convenient to install, and the cigarette rotates stably, and the punching precision is high.
